Output 7393d99760d1e3abcc48898782c2c31aabb12294b854cc96b096c2a4d60a1ead:138

value
18279932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d1379fe8f95e9b8c6f21855c429053f56937d78 OP_EQUAL
address
3ABA6dwd7bWiE5Y98PNv2EYYG3EtT9HFie
transaction
7393d99760d1e3abcc48898782c2c31aabb12294b854cc96b096c2a4d60a1ead
confirmations
344587
spent
true